Holiday season is upon us or vacation for many, as we come into the summer months.

Collectors will at this time have favourite timepieces to take with them depending on the type of break they are embarking on . Beach , city visit, adventure or activity laden trip or spa / wellness retreat as examples.


The world is smaller , more accessible and for watch enthusiasts / collectors travelling it , some have long hours ahead of choice paralysis.

Enthusiasts will start debate with other collectors at this time and wrestle with themselves as to what pieces to take and leave , how many and which are suitable depending on their vacation needs.

Thought turn to if due to periods away from home if storage is required for other pieces left behind.

Safety concerns then creep in , taking watches away to certain places of the planet can be a risk due to increased awareness of criminals to profit from watch theft.

It is a very first world problem granted, taking a watch roll or equivalent with any watches is a luxury and probably shouldn’t  be the first priority. Maybe travel insurance or remembering the kids at the airport first.

What type of watch to take

Some will decide to take “ beaters” affordable every day pieces which are a bit rugged and withstand most pursuits while not drawing attention or risking theft.

But then there are those who cannot take one watch for a period of time , want something dressier for evening or a selection for the time they are away.

Of course this is all built into the fundamental collector’s mentality. We collect to wear and not worry. That statement is simplistic in reality.

Would you take a very expensive dress watch on a hike , probably not purely from a practical level but equally would you want to dine by lake Garda of an evening in one, possibly.

Of course , what excuse to pack a GMT , even if it’s a two hour time zone difference ahead or behind your local time which your phone will update when entering that zone.

Then there are those who wish to take a piece with them as a reminder , memory or just because it matches their clothing.

I fit somewhere in the middle , I don’t travel light but equally don’t take too many , or maybe I do. I take a variety to suit day and night , diver , dress etc.
